The rules are simple, the sessions are quick, and your friend group will spend more time arguing than playing, in the best way.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Online or local Wi-Fi. <strong>Players:<\/strong> 4 to 15. <str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Perfect if you like playful betrayal and reading each other.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>2) Minecraft<\/strong> Best Co-Op Sandbox For Long Sessions<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Minecraft is the ultimate shared-world co-op game. It works for couples because the game supports different playstyles in the same world. One of you can build, one of you can explore, and you still feel like you are working toward the same home base.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> A Realm lets you run a persistent world.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> You plus up to 10 other players at the same time.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Build something that is &#8220;yours&#8221; and keep expanding it week after week.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>3) Roblox<\/strong> Best Multiplayer Variety On Mobile<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Roblox is not one game, it is a platform. The upside is obvious: you can bounce between co-op obstacle courses, social hangouts, <a href=\"https:\/\/hone.gg\/blog\/roblox-horror-games\/\">horror runs<\/a>, and mini games without installing something new every time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Join friends inside experiences when joining is enabled.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Varies by experience.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great when you both want variety but do not want to learn a complex system.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>4) Genshin Impact<\/strong> Best Co-Op Action RPG On Mobile<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Genshin is a strong pick when you want progression, exploration, and co-op farming with a partner. The co-op is not the whole game, but it is enough to turn daily play into a shared routine.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Co-Op Mode.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Up to 4.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Plan builds together and treat it like a weekly co-op grind instead of a solo checklist.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>5) Sky: Children Of The Light<\/strong> Best Chill Co-Op For Couples<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Sky is the opposite of sweaty. It is soft, social, and designed around meeting up, exploring, and helping each other through quiet moments. If you want a calming co-op mobile game that still feels like an adventure, this is a top-tier choice.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Teleport and meet up with friends.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Up to 8 in the same area.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Ideal for winding down and talking while you play.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>6) Bloons TD 6<\/strong> Best Co-Op Strategy Game On Mobile<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Bloons TD 6 is co-op comfort food. You can keep it casual or go deep with optimization, and the co-op structure makes it easy to feel like you are building one defense together.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Co-op on maps and modes.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Up to 4.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great if you like planning and celebrating clean wins together.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>7) Terraria<\/strong> Best Co-Op Survival And Boss Progression<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Terraria is a classic co-op loop: explore, upgrade, fight a boss, unlock the next phase, repeat. It is ideal for couples who want a shared progression ladder without needing constant competitive focus.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Multiplayer worlds.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Up to 8.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> One of the best &#8220;we beat this together&#8221; feelings on mobile.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>8) Human: Fall Flat<\/strong> Funniest Co-Op Puzzle Game With Friends<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Human: Fall Flat is a co-op comedy generator. The puzzles are open-ended, and the physics makes every attempt feel like a shared blooper reel. This is the right pick when you want laughs more than mastery.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Online multiplayer. <strong>Players:<\/strong> Up to 4 on mobile. <str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Perfect for a relaxed night where winning is optional.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>9) Pok\u00e9mon UNITE<\/strong> Best 5v5 Team Game For Duos<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Pok\u00e9mon UNITE is one of the cleanest duo-queue games on mobile. Two of you can coordinate roles, rotate together, and actually feel like you are influencing the match as a unit.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Team battles.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Format:<\/strong> Two teams of five.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great when you want competitive teamwork without a huge time commitment.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>10) Brawl Stars<\/strong> Best Quick Multiplayer Matches With Friends<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>This game works because it is fast, but it also makes it even more important to not experience any <a href=\"https:\/\/www.exitlag.com\/blog\/brawl-stars-lag-game\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" title=\"\">Brawl Stars lag<\/a>. You can hop in, run a few matches, and hop out without needing an hour block. If you want a game that stays social even when you only have 10 minutes, this is it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Multiple team modes.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Formats:<\/strong> 3v3 and 5v5 options.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> A strong &#8220;one more match&#8221; game that does not demand a full night.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>11) League Of Legends: Wild Rift<\/strong> Best Competitive 5v5 On Mobile<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Wild Rift is for couples and friend groups who like a real competitive ladder and coordinated team play. If you both enjoy learning matchups, timing fights, and improving together, it hits hard.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Team up with friends.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Format:<\/strong> 5v5 MOBA combat.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Best when you treat improvement as the shared goal.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>12) Mobile Legends: Bang Bang<\/strong> Best Fast 5v5 MOBA Sessions<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Mobile Legends is an easy MOBA to make social because the matches are fast and the queue is quick. It is a solid pick if you want the teamfight energy without overthinking every detail.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Queue as a duo or squad.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Format:<\/strong> 5v5.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Strong when you want competitive energy but still want to relax.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>13) PUBG MOBILE<\/strong> Best Squad Battle Royale On Phones<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>PUBG MOBILE is a go-to for friend groups because it supports both serious comms and casual chaos. You can play it like a tactical shooter or a social hangout where funny mistakes become the highlight.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Classic Mode and faster modes.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Formats:<\/strong> 100-player battles in Classic Mode and 4v4 Arena battles.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great if you like coordinating without needing perfect mechanics.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>14) Call Of Duty: Mobile<\/strong> Best Multiplayer Shooter With Friends<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Call of Duty: Mobile is still one of the easiest shooters to play socially. It gives you classic multiplayer modes and a battle royale option, so your group can switch vibes without switching games.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Team-based multiplayer plus battle royale.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Group Size:<\/strong> Varies by mode.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Strong when you want action without the slow pacing of survival games.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>15) Clash Royale<\/strong> Best Quick 2v2 Game For Couples<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Clash Royale is a great &#8220;two matches before bed&#8221; game because it is quick, skill-based, and easy to discuss together. 2v2 gives you shared decision making without the pressure of solo ladder stress.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> 2v2 with a friend.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Format:<\/strong> 2v2.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great if you like small strategy conversations and quick wins.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>16) Pok\u00e9mon GO<\/strong> Best Outdoor Co-Op Game For Couples<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Pok\u00e9mon GO is not a couch co-op game, it is a co-op routine. It works for couples because it turns a walk into a shared objective. Meet up, hit a route, jump into raids, and call it a date that also levels your account.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Raid Battles and group activities.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Raid groups are limited to 20.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> A legit reason to get outside together.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>17) The Past Within<\/strong> Best Co-Op Puzzle Game For Couples<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The Past Within is built for two people. You and your partner see different worlds and you have to communicate to solve puzzles. It is co-op that actually feels cooperative.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Co-op only.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> 2.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Important:<\/strong> Both players need their own copy and a way to communicate.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>18) Tick Tock: A Tale For Two<\/strong> Best Two-Screen Mystery<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>This is one of the best two-player mobile games because it forces real teamwork. Each person has half the information, and you only win if you explain what you see clearly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Cooperative puzzle solving on two devices.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> 2.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> The perfect test of communication in the nicest way.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>19) Keep Talking &amp; Nobody Explodes<\/strong> Best Communication Stress Test<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>One person defuses a bomb, everyone else guides them using the manual. It is intense, funny, and surprisingly good at turning &#8220;we are fine&#8221; into &#8220;we need a better system&#8221; in about 90 seconds.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Local co-op party setup.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> Two or more local players.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> If you like solving problems under pressure, it is unbeatable.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>20) Spaceteam<\/strong> Best Local Party Game On Phones<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Spaceteam is chaos on purpose. Everyone is shouting weird instructions, everyone is pushing buttons, and your ship is probably exploding. It is not calm, but it is memorable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Play Together:<\/strong> Local Wi-Fi party play.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Players:<\/strong> 2 to 8. <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Couple Angle:<\/strong> Great for double dates and group hangouts.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wb\"> <h4 class=\"wb-title\">Do Not Pick A Co-Op Game That Fights Your Schedule<\/h4> <p class=\"wb-text\">If you and your partner only have 15 minutes, do not force a long progression game.
